St Roch or Roque of Montpellier (1295-1327). Oil on oak board. Barend van Orley (1487/1491-1541) Flemish Northern Renaissance painter. Roch distributing wealth, pilgrim to Italy, recovering from plague in forest, imprisoned

EDITORS COMMENTS
This print showcases a remarkable masterpiece by Barend van Orley, a prominent Flemish Northern Renaissance painter. The painting depicts the revered figure of St Roch or Roque of Montpellier, who lived during the late 13th and early 14th centuries. Created using oil on oak board in the 16th century, this artwork beautifully captures various significant moments from St Roch's life. In this composition, we witness St Roch distributing wealth to those in need, embodying his selfless nature and devotion to helping others. Another scene portrays him as a pilgrim traveling to Italy, seeking spiritual enlightenment and solace. Additionally, the painting illustrates his miraculous recovery from the plague while taking refuge in a forest. The artist skillfully conveys St Roch's resilience through these powerful visuals. Furthermore, there is an intriguing depiction of him being imprisoned—a testament to his unwavering faith even amidst adversity.
